#567dba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#567dba is composed of 33.7% red, 49% green and 72.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.8% cyan, 32.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 216.6 degrees, a saturation of 42% and a lightness of 53.3%. #567dba color hex could be obtained by blending #acfaff with #000075.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#567dba color description : Moderate blue.

#567dba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#567dba has RGB values of R:86, G:125, B:186 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0.33,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 5668282.

Shades and Tints of #567dba

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05080c is the darkest color, while #fdf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#567dba

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#84878c is the less saturated color, while #166ffa is the most saturated one.
